The Names of God Part 12 - Jehovah-Ahavah

by Gail Rodgers
The LORD of Love. Take a few minutes today to recall the faithfulness of the Lord to you as you look back on your life.

Where are the places you could feel Him and see Him at work? Where were the places when He seemed absent yet with hindsight you found He was there all along? God is faithful; He will be faithful and He calls us to trust His love and faithfulness today.
  • The LORD, the Compassionate and Gracious God, Slow to anger, Abounding in Love and Faithfulness, Maintaining love to thousands, Forgiving wickedness, rebellion and sin, Yet He does not leave the guilty unpunished. Isaiah 63:9, Ex 34:6, 7
  • His love reaches to the heavens, His faithfulness reaches to the skies, His righteousness is like the mighty mountains. Ps 36:5-6
  • He is Faithful to all His promises and Loving toward all He has made, He is near to all who call upon Him. Ps 145:13; Ps 145:18
